    Default Jbr short shift plate

    I recently bought the jbr ssp and brushing. Works like a charm, although with my factory air intake box still in there. They clash on all the top gears "1-3-5". You can see the box move everytime I select those to gears. And you can feel the difficulty getting into those gears due to the clashing. anyone else have this problem, and any advice? I've already ordered my corksport Sri and tip from the U.S, so I'm just waiting on that.

    Quote Originally Posted by imiz89 View Post
    The issue is the the ssp hitting the airbox, will the adjustment of the lug fix that?
    On the JBR website he has instructions on what to do to correct your factory airbox hitting the SSP As Boost said, it involves a spacer or if you still have your standard bushings where you replaced with your JBR solid Bushings then you can use those to do the mod. all the best. cheers.
